With our popular set of 2 upcycled cushion covers, you can decorate your home with textile in a more sustainable way than buying alternatives made with new materials. We produce all our home textiles by upcycling waste from laundry houses in Denmark. This means we use 70% CO2 and 97% less water to make our products compared to the same product made with brand new materials.

As this product is made with discarded white uniforms, the textiles has been dyed with 100% GOTS certified organic dyes in the EU. The timeless design means it will look great all year round, so you can accessorise your sofa or bed with a good conscience.

What is upcycling?

Upcycling means that we reuse the parts of the discarded garments that are still in good condition, instead of mechanically or chemically recycling them into new yarn. We manually sort through each item by hand to find the reusable pieces we can upcycle into items such as washcloths, dishcloths, tea towels, cushion covers, foot stools and toiletry bags, amongst other things.

We cut out what is reusable and sew it back together into new home textiles. This is the most environmentally friendly way to handle the waste because very little energy and water is required, in comparison with a recycled product, where the material has to be broken down and often mixed with polyester in order to bind the shorter fibres.
